Web3.11.1.5.2 Lead alloys. Of the elements commonly found in lead alloys, zinc and bismuth aggravate corrosion in most circumstances, while additions of copper, tellurium, antimony, nickel, silver, tin, arsenic, and calcium affect corrosion resistance only slightly, or may even improve it depending on the service conditions. WebCerrosafe is a fusible alloy with a low melting point.It is a non-eutectic mixture consisting of 42.5% bismuth, 37.7% lead, 11.3% tin, and 8.5% cadmium that melts between 158 °F (70 °C) and 190 °F (88 °C).It is useful for making reference castings whose dimensions can be correlated to those of the mold or other template due to its well-known thermal expansion …
